stanza
/ˈstænzə/noun
Middle School
1
A unit of a poem, written or printed as a paragraph; equivalent to a verse.
2
An apartment or division in a building.
3
An XML element which acts as basic unit of meaning in XMPP.
4
A section of a configuration file consisting of a related group of lines.
5
A segment; a portion of a broadcast devoted to a particular topic.
6
A period; an interval into which a sporting event is divided.
